I'm so glad we booked our stay inside the Xiangshawan Desert Scenic Area! It made everything so incredibly easy. Each room came with 6 bottles of water, and the air conditioning was already on before we even arrived. Even though it's a yurt, the interior space is very large, and the private bathroom is super clean. The hotel's services were all excellent. The all-inclusive meals were not at all superficial; each meal featured local specialties like lamb offal soup, savory milk tea, and plenty of beef and lamb. The quality was on par with outside restaurants, and we all agreed their milk tea was the best we had during our entire trip. After a fun day exploring the two islands, returning to the hotel wasn't boring at all. In the evenings, there were disco parties, firework displays, and stargazing. Every event was well-organized and very entertaining. It truly lived up to its nickname, 'Desert Disney'! Definitely worth the trip!
